New "Loading siding" at Papplewick Pumping Station 2007


David Ambler trying out the new loading ramp siding at Papplewick (05/09/2007)
Built by the "A" team in one afternoon.

David at the end of the siding, the track about level with the top of the mechanical lift.
The lift is in the process of being repainted, then totally covered with 'pit' conveyor belting to allow the lift to be used for track loco's or road loco's.

At the moment the track is built in 7 1/4" gauge, later the 5" rail will be added.
The track mounting blocks will be re-laid sideways to improve stability.
The lift is 4' long
